 YOU are your child’s first teacher  We will work together as a team to help your child develop socially and academically  Open lines of communication are needed  Take an active role in your child’s education o Talk to your child about his/her day o Look for papers that come home o Ensure your child completes his/her homework Cate Hatt Deb Hurlburt

 Read with your child for 20 minutes every day  Talk to your child about what is happening in the pictures and in the story  Have your child chime in when there are rhyming or repeated phrases  Read from a broad selection of books o Nursery rhymes, fairy tales, poetry o Wordless books  Read with expression Amanda Ducharme

 Make your child’s name  Make the alphabet and sing it  Sort letters  Match uppercase and lowercase letters  Games o Closest to A (or Z) o What’s the Missing Letter? Fun with Magnetic Letters

Amanda Ducharme  Rhyming words o Discrimination o Production  Blending sounds Fun with Sounds Phonological skills lay an important foundation for success in reading

 Have your child: o Count or sort a collection of objects o Notice patterns in our everyday world o Use decks of cards or games with dice to create fun activities that involve numbers  Integrate mathematics into your family’s time together: o Sort silverware o Match pairs of socks o Order pans by size o Find the largest/smallest flower Lisa Schumacher
